在网络安全的 ever-changing 时代,VPN 已成为不可或缺的一部分,作为现代网络架构中的重要组成部分,构建一个可靠的VPN系统,需要我们对网络设备和操作系统有着深入的了解,本文将重点介绍如何在 Linux 环境中构建一个安全可靠的VPN系统。

什么是VPN

VPN(虚拟网络)是一种通过中间人(即中控站)连接来自一个网络源地址和一个网络目标地址的网络设备,从而实现网络加密传输的网络协议,VPN 的核心目的是在数据传输过程中提供加密和虚拟连接,从而保护数据的安全性。

构建VPN的步骤

构建一个VPN系统需要遵循以下步骤:

  1. 选择VPN协议 VPN 的核心在于选择合适的加密协议,常用的协议包括 SSL/TLS、OpenVPN、VPN等,选择合适的协议需要考虑数据传输的安全性和可靠性。

  2. 选择中控站 中控站是VPN系统的核心,负责加密传输的数据和控制流,常见的中控站有 Tor、OpenVPN、Parasol 等,选择中控站还需要考虑其兼容性和安全性。

  3. 配置防火墙 网络防火墙是保障数据传输安全的关键工具,在构建VPN系统时,需要在防火墙中设置相应的规则,来控制流量的发送和接收。

  4. 搭建VPN连接 在网络设备上安装相关的VPN软件,Tor 安全引擎、OpenVPN 安全引擎等,然后将源端口和目标端口设置为加密连接。

  5. 设置加密协议 在 Tor 安全引擎中,需要选择合适的加密协议(如 TLS 1.2 或 TLS 1.3),并设置相应的加密参数,如密钥大小、加密方式等。

  6. 扩展到其他端口 VPN 系统通常需要与多个端口建立连接,因此需要在 Tor 安全引擎中设置扩展端口功能,以便在传输过程中支持更多的端口。

  7. 测试和优化 构建好 VPN 系统后,需要进行多轮测试,确保数据传输的安全性和可靠性和稳定性,也可以根据用户的具体需求进行优化,例如调整加密参数、升级中控站等。

构建VPN的优势

构建一个VPN系统需要面对一系列的技术挑战,因此需要注意以下几点:

  1. 安全性 VPN 系统需要在加密传输过程中彻底隔离数据,因此需要依靠可靠的网络设备和加密协议,选择合适的协议和中控站是确保数据安全的关键。

  2. 灵活性 VPN 系统通常需要支持多个端口和多个用户,因此需要具备灵活的配置能力,这一点在现代网络环境中尤为重要。

  3. 扩展性 VPN 系统需要能够扩展到更多端口和用户,因此需要具备良好的扩展能力和管理能力。

  4. 安全性 VPN 系统需要具备完善的安全监控和备份机制,确保数据的完整性和安全性。

构建VPN的常见问题及解决方案

在构建 VPN 系统的过程中,可能会遇到一些常见的问题,例如防火墙配置不当导致数据丢失,加密协议选择不合理,中控站设置错误等,针对这些问题,可以采取以下措施:

  1. 防火墙配置 在配置防火墙时,需要确保数据的来源端口和目标端口都被正确地隔离,可以使用 Tor 安全引擎中的防火墙配置工具,设置相应的规则和过滤。

  2. 加密协议选择 在选择加密协议时,需要根据数据传输的安全性和可靠性来决定,对于高安全性的应用,可以选择 TLS 1.3;而对于低安全性的应用,可以选择 AES-256。

  3. 中控站配置 在配置中控站时,需要确保中控站的性能良好,能够支持 VPN 系统的高吞吐量和多用户支持,可以参考 Tor 安全引擎提供的配置指南,确保中控站的稳定性和可靠。

  4. 网络设备配置 在构建 VPN 系统时,需要确保网络设备如 Tor 安全引擎、防火墙等都配置良好,具备足够的性能来支持 VPN 系统的运行。

推荐VPN服务

在构建 VPN 系统的过程中,可以选择一些知名的VPN服务,如 Tor、OpenVPN、Parasol 等,这些服务提供了丰富的功能和完善的配置支持,帮助用户快速构建VPN系统。

  1. Tor Tor 是一个开源的 VPN 容器,支持多端口、多用户构建,它提供了多种配置选项,适合需要高安全性和多用户支持的用户。

  2. OpenVPN OpenVPN 是一个开源的 VPN 引擎,支持多种协议和端口,它提供了用户友好的界面和完善的配置工具,适合需要高可靠性的用户。

  3. Parasol Parasol 是一个功能强大的 VPN 容器,支持多端口、多用户构建,它提供了丰富的功能和详细的文档支持,适合需要高灵活性和高安全性的用户。

  4. VPN 官方服务 VPN 官方服务如 Tor 安全引擎、OpenVPN 安全引擎等,提供了丰富的功能和完善的配置工具,帮助用户快速构建VPN系统。

构建VPN的总结

构建 VPN 系统是一个技术挑战,需要我们具备扎实的网络环境和丰富的配置能力,选择合适的协议和中控站是确保数据安全的关键,通过 Tor、OpenVPN 等 VPN 容器,我们可以轻松构建一个高效的VPN系统,满足用户的需求,在构建 VPN 系统时,需要关注安全性、灵活性和扩展性等问题,通过合理配置和使用可靠的工具,可以快速构建一个安全可靠的 VPN 系统。

构建 VPN 系统需要我们付出时间和努力,但一旦构建成功,可以为用户提供一个安全、可靠的网络环境,提升用户的安全感和满意度。

构建VPN,从配置到安全  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速